J P Westall Limited is seeking a full-time Electrician based in Hexham, Northumberland. This role involves installing and commissioning various heating and renewable technologies, primarily in domestic properties.

The position offers a competitive salary of £45,000, along with minimal travel within the North East, a company van, fuel card, and performance bonuses. Join a friendly, supportive team with opportunities for training and career growth.

How to prepare for a job interview at J P Westall Limited

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of domestic renewable technologies. Be ready to discuss specific systems you've worked with, like heat pumps or solar panels, and how you've installed or commissioned them in the past.

Show Your Team Spirit

Since J P Westall Limited values a friendly and supportive team, be prepared to share examples of how you've collaborated with others in previous roles. Highlight any experiences where teamwork led to successful project outcomes.

Ask Smart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ture, training opportunities, and the types of projects you'll be working on.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
